Keys to successful bath-time relaxation

Hotel rooms just don’t feel like home. In fact, some hotels don’t even have a bathtub…only a shower. Our travel nurse housing offers a homey atmosphere with a traditional bathtub and a shower feature. Of course, bathtime offers a number of benefits besides just getting clean. It can help your muscles to release tension and your mind to focus on a comforting daily routine. To get the full effect, you’ll want to prepare for your bath by using the suggestions below…

  • The first key to a stress-relieving bath is time. If you have a lot to get done while at home or need to run some errands, you won’t get the full enjoyment of a bath. Allow yourself to stop worrying about patients at the hospital or other stresses of the day.
  • Make sure your bathroom area is clean or uncluttered. This will help you not to focus on extraneous things, but only on yourself.
  • Get a clean, dry towel to have on hand when needed. Each of our condos feature large bath towels as well as washer and dryer units for renters to use.
  • Light a couple of candles if desired.
  • Bring a favorite book if you like to read.
  • Use Spotify or another similar app on your phone if music helps you to unwind.
  • Bring chocolate, a glass of wine or other snacks into the bathroom…just to treat yourself.
